ABSTRACT:
A charged first molecular species is separated from a second molecular species by selectively passing one of the species through a separation membrane under the influence of an electrical potential. The separated species is maintained within a dialysate stream by retention membrane (or an electrode surface) adjacent the separation membrane. In a first embodiment, the charged species migrates across the separation membrane under the influence of the electric field, while a neutral or oppositely-charged species is maintained within the aqueous media. In the second embodiment, the charged species is maintained with the load channel, while a neutral species is passed into the dialysate chamber under the influence of a differential pressure.
